[发明专利]一种终端屏幕响应时间测量方法、装置及终端设备在审
| 申请号: | 201911281909.8 | 申请日: | 2019-12-13 |
| 公开(公告)号: | CN111090570A | 公开(公告)日: | 2020-05-01 |
| 发明(设计)人: | 王明远 | 申请(专利权)人: | OPPO广东移动通信有限公司 |
| 主分类号: | G06F11/34 | 分类号: | G06F11/34;G06F11/22;G06F3/0488 |
| 代理公司: | 深圳市恒申知识产权事务所(普通合伙) 44312 | 代理人: | 鲍竹 |
| 地址: | 523860 广东*** | 国省代码: | 广东;44 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 终端 屏幕 响应 时间 测量方法 装置 终端设备 | ||
1.一种终端屏幕响应时间测量方法,其特征在于,包括:
获取终端控制中心接收到中断信号的中断接收时间点,其中,所述中断信号为终端屏幕响应于触摸动作后,所述终端屏幕向所述终端控制中心发送的硬件信号;
获取终端界面刷新的完成时间点,其中,刷新后的终端界面为所述终端控制中心响应于所述中断信号后,重新绘制的新的终端界面;
根据所述中断接收时间点和所述完成时间点计算终端屏幕响应耗时。
2.如权利要求1所述的终端屏幕响应时间测量方法,其特征在于,所述获取终端控制中心接收到中断信号的中断接收时间点之前,包括:
设置界面刷新按钮,并监听所述触摸动作;
当所述触摸动作触发所述界面刷新按钮时,触发终端屏幕响应时间测量事件,以使所述终端屏幕向所述终端控制中心发送所述中断信号,所述中断信号用于使所述终端控制中心重新绘制新的终端界面。
3.如权利要求2所述的终端屏幕响应时间测量方法,其特征在于,所述当所述触摸动作触发所述界面刷新按钮时,触发所述终端屏幕响应时间测量事件之后,包括:
获取所述触摸动作触发界面刷新按钮的触发时间点;
获取基于所述触发时间点之后,所述终端控制中心接收的硬件信号,以及所述终端控制中心接收所述硬件信号的接收时间记录;
通过Systrace获取所述硬件信号中的中断信号,以及所述终端控制中心接收所述中断信号的接收时间记录。
4.如权利要求1所述的终端屏幕响应时间测量方法,其特征在于,所述获取中断信号的中断接收时间点,包括:
根据中断信号的接收时间记录和触发时间点分析所述中断信号的中断接收时间点。
5.如权利要求1所述的终端屏幕响应时间测量方法,其特征在于,所述获取终端控制中心接收到中断信号的中断接收时间点,包括:
调用SurfaceFlinger输出更替后的每帧终端界面的绘制完成时间点;
按照帧数顺序排列所述绘制完成时间点;
以末帧的绘制完成时间点作为所述终端界面交替的完成时间点。
6.如权利要求5所述的终端屏幕响应时间测量方法,其特征在于,按照帧数顺序排列所述绘制完成时间点之前,包括:
计算所述终端界面刷新的更替时间;
若所述更替时间在预设范围内,则执行按照帧数顺序排列所述绘制完成时间点的步骤;
若所述更替时间在预设范围外,则检测所述终端界面的更替异常事件,并标记出现更替异常的终端界面。
7.如权利要求6所述的终端屏幕响应时间测量方法,其特征在于,所述检测所述终端界面的更替异常事件,包括:
获取第i帧终端界面的绘制时间;
将第i帧终端界面的绘制时间与标准绘制时间进行对比;
若所述第i帧终端界面的绘制时间与所述标准绘制时间之差在误差范围内,则第i帧终端界面的绘制正常;
若所述第i帧终端界面的绘制时间与所述标准绘制时间之差在误差范围外,则第i帧终端界面的绘制异常。
8.一种终端屏幕响应时间测量装置,其特征在于,包括:
中断接收时间点获取模块,用于获取终端控制中心接收到中断信号的中断接收时间点,其中,所述中断信号为终端屏幕响应于触摸动作后,所述终端屏幕向所述终端控制中心发送的硬件信号;
完成时间点获取模块,用于获取终端界面刷新的完成时间点,其中,刷新后的终端界面为所述终端控制中心响应于所述中断信号后,重新绘制的新的终端界面;
终端屏幕响应时间测量模块,用于根据所述中断接收时间点和所述完成时间点计算终端屏幕响应耗时。
9.一种终端设备,其特征在于,包括存储器、处理器及存储在存储器上并可在处理器上运行的计算机程序,所述处理器执行所述计算机程序时,实现如权利要求1至7任一项所述的终端屏幕响应时间测量方法中的各个步骤。
10.一种存储介质,所述存储介质为计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时,实现如权利要求1至7任一项所述的终端屏幕响应时间测量方法中的各个步骤。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于OPPO广东移动通信有限公司,未经OPPO广东移动通信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201911281909.8/1.html,转载请声明来源钻瓜专利网。





